P2E63
Engine Coolant Bypass Valve E Control Circuit Low
P2E63 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: Engine Coolant Bypass Valve E Control Circuit Low. Common causes: coolant bypass valve malfunction, open or short circuit in control circuit. Estimated repair cost: $17–56.
Symptoms
- Incorrect operation of the cooling system
- Engine overheating
- Unstable engine temperature
- Check Engine Light Illuminates
- Reduced engine efficiency
Causes
- Coolant bypass valve malfunction
- Open or short circuit in control circuit
- Poor contact in control circuit connectors
- Engine control unit (ECU) malfunction
- Corroded or damaged wires
How to Fix
- Check the condition of the coolant bypass valve
- Check the integrity of the control circuit and connectors
- Measure resistance and voltage in the circuit
- If necessary, replace the valve or repair the circuit
- Check and update ECU software if necessary
